About Eleven Intuitions

Eleven Intuitions PodcastReal stories. Real spirit. Real growth. The Eleven Intuitions Podcast takes you behind the scenes of a thriving mediumship community — from the pivotal moments that shaped founder Melissa’s own journey, to the experiences of the students, team members, and sitters who make up the heart of Eleven Intuitions. We explore everything about mediumship: the beauty, the challenges, the healing, and the raw truth that often gets left out of the highlight reel. You’ll hear personal stories, lessons from teaching and mentoring new mediums, and honest conversations about what it really means to live and work with spirit. Whether you’re curious about developing your own gifts, fascinated by behind-the-scenes mediumship work, or simply love a good story that blends the spiritual with the human, you’ll find it here. Welcome to Eleven Intuitions — where every connection matters, every voice has a place, and the journey is just as important as the destination.

Mother’s Day Without Her Even Though I Can Still Talk to Her on the Other Side

This episode wasn’t planned, but it needed to happen. I didn’t have a sitter for my student today, which usually means spirit has something else in mind. And today, it was my mom. She came through with memories that only she and I would know. Specific, personal, undeniable pieces of evidence. And what made it even more powerful was what it did for my student. After a rough week of practicing and questioning herself, this reading helped her rebuild her confidence in a way I couldn’t teach. But this episode goes deeper than that. It’s been 10 years since my mom passed, and she is still here. Still helping me. Still showing up when it matters most. I also answer one of the questions I get asked all the time. Is it easier to lose someone when you are a medium and can still talk to them? My answer might surprise you. And after doing and sitting in on hundreds of readings, I am sharing something I wish more people understood. Do not wait until it is too late to heal your relationships. I have seen what happens when people come to a medium trying to fix things after someone has passed. After words were not said. After relationships were left broken. And I have seen the unimaginable pain of estrangement through a dear friend. Not just losing a child, but losing access to grandchildren too. Listen to this episode and feel the love that came through from my mom, and how connected she still is to me and her grandchildren. That love didn’t die when she did… so why should it die here on earth? If there is something that needs to be healed in your life, do it now. So you do not have to sit across from someone like me later, wishing you had. This episode is about mediumship, grief, healing, and the truth about what really matters while we are still here.

The Grief Nobody Talks About. When Work Was Family

The Grief Nobody Talks About: When Work Was Family This episode is raw. In this deeply personal conversation, I share the story of how my husband and I met at work, built our life around a place that once felt like family, and what happens when that sense of belonging slowly disappears. This is not a story about blame, companies, or decisions. It’s about the kind of grief people rarely name. The grief that comes when work is more than a paycheck. When it’s identity, purpose, routine, and community. And what happens to a person, and a family, when that is taken away after decades of loyalty. We talk about how this kind of loss shows up quietly. In forgetfulness. In irritability. In animals acting out. In a household feeling heavy before anyone has words for it. We talk about what it’s like to watch someone you love feel defeated, disconnected from their sense of worth, and unsure of who they are without the role they lived inside of for so long. This episode is about invisible grief. It’s about love, identity, and rebuilding. And it’s about hope that doesn’t erase the pain, but opens a new door. If you or someone you love is navigating job loss, career upheaval, or the quiet grief that comes with starting over, this episode is for you. You are not failing. You are not broken. And you are not alone.

What Comes After Writing, Loss, and Healing with Author Sara Escobar

In this episode of the Eleven Intuitions Podcast, Melissa sits down with author Sara Escobar for an honest, thoughtful conversation about writing as a lifeline, navigating loss, and finding meaning after life changes you forever. Sara shares the stories behind her poetry collections Old Flames and Wildflowers and Ashes & Stardust: What Comes After, reflecting on heartbreak, grief, love, memory, and the quiet ways we learn to carry what we’ve lost. Together, they explore how words can hold what feels impossible to say, how creativity becomes a form of healing, and what it looks like to keep moving forward without pretending everything is “fixed.” This episode isn’t about rushing through pain or tying life up neatly. It’s about truth, tenderness, and the space we give ourselves to feel, reflect, and keep writing our way through whatever comes next.
